Sec. 423.46 Late enrollment penalty. (a) General. A Part D eligible individual must pay the late penalty described under Sec. 423.286(d)(3) if there is a continuous period of 63 days or longer at any time after the end of the individual's initial enrollment period during which the individual meets all of the following conditions: (1) The individual was eligible to enroll in a Part D plan; (2) The individual was not covered under any creditable prescription drug coverage; and (3) The individual was not enrolled in a Part D plan.
